序:把钱包当作仪表盘——对DeFi的观察既要宏观也要技术化。
一、总体架构(概念图)
1) 客户端:TP钱包(本地Keystore/助记词、签名模块、RPC配置)。
2) 网络层:RPC节点、WebSocket、mempool。3) 数据层:区块链账本、合约日志(events)、索引器(The Graph/自建Subgraph)、二次数据库(Postgres/Redis)。4) 应用层:收益计算器、前端UI、异步任务队列。
二、链上数据与个人信息
- 链上数据:tx hash、from/to、value、logs、event topics、block timestamp。通过合约ABI解析events,可精确重构swap、mint、redeem、transfer行为。
- 个人信息:钱包地址为伪匿名标识,地址聚类、交易图谱可还原行为模式;避免泄露建议使用独立地址、走隐私工具或中继服务。
三、实时数据处理流程(详细步骤)

1) 订阅新块(WebSocket)或轮询RPC。2) 从区块抓取tx并过滤目标合约地址。3) 解析logs -> 转换为结构化事件(标准化字段:user, poolId, amount, token)。4) 写入Redis做低延迟缓存,并入队列到后端计算器。5) 后端按epoch/每块更新收益快照,计算未分发奖励并触发合约调用或生成Merkle证明供离线claim。
四、收益分配与合约交互
- 模型:按份额(share)或按时间衰减(rate)分配;费用分摊基于swap fees+protocol fees。智能合约通过checkpoint记录用户份额,按epoch发放或生成Merkle Root做批量领取。
- 流程:索引器生成快照 -> 后端确认分配逻辑 -> 构造分发tx或生成领取证明 -https://www.yhznai.com ,> 签名并提交 -> 监听分发events -> 更新用户界面和历史账本。
五、数字化生活与信息化技术发展建议
- 趋势:Layer2、zk隐私、链下高频结算将加速DeFi融入日常支付与资产管理。

- 安全建议:本地签名+硬件钱包、使用可信RPC或自建节点、对敏感索引做差分隐私处理、对外API限速与认证。
结语:将TP钱包作为一个边缘节点,你既能观察链上原始信号,也可通过严密的数据管道把这些信号转为可用的收益与风险指标——这是把数字化生活变成可控资产流的技术路径。
评论
Crypto小明
很实用,尤其是对事件解析和索引器部分讲得清楚。
AnnaLee
收益分配用Merkle证明的思路很棒,便于扩展和审计。
链上观察者
关于隐私保护的建议值得采纳,尤其是独立地址和差分隐私处理。
Tom_Wu
希望能出个配套的流程图或脚本示例,便于实操。